non miscible
/nɑnˈmɪsəbəl/
adjective
- Describing two or more liquids that do not mix together to form a single uniform substance.
- The salad dressing separates because vinegar and oil are non-miscible.
- In the chemistry lab, we observed that hexane and water are non-miscible.
- Oil and water are non-miscible, so they separate into layers.
